U.S. crude fell 5% in response to the announcement. Pakistan Prime Minister Shehbaz Sharif said an official signing ceremony would take place on Friday in Switzerland.
U.S. And Iran. Investors are watching for economic data on housing and retail sales this week. They will also closely monitor the Federal Reserve policy meeting, which has a more than 98% chance of ending with rates unchanged, according to CME's FedWatch tool.
"Given the recent uptick in inflation, we think Wednesday's Federal Reserve meeting itself in terms of any monetary policy changes will be a snoozer," said Michael Landsberg, chief investment officer at Landsberg Bennett private wealth management. 01%. Yields and prices move in opposite directions.
